A gusting north wind combined with fresh snow is reducing visibility Tuesday night and that is resulting in some highway closures, including Highway 75, part of Highway 59, and Highway 205.

Poor visibility is reported on most highways across southern Manitoba.

We can expect a strong north wind to reach up to 70 km/h overnight with a windchill of -34 and a risk of frostbite.

The wind will become light during the afternoon.
